🔥 Как создать таблицу PL/SQL: простой и подробный гайд для начинающих 🔥
CREATE TABLE имя_таблицы
(
столбец1 тип_данных1,
столбец2 тип_данных2,
...
);
Замените "имя_таблицы" на желаемое имя для вашей таблицы, а "столбец1", "столбец2", и так далее на имена и типы данных для ваших столбцов. Например:
CREATE TABLE employees
(
id NUMBER,
name VARCHAR2(50),
department VARCHAR2(50)
);
В этом примере мы создаем таблицу "employees" с тремя столбцами: "id" типа NUMBER, "name" типа VARCHAR2(50), и "department" типа VARCHAR2(50).
Не забудьте использовать точку с запятой в конце оператора CREATE TABLE.
Я надеюсь, это поможет вам создать таблицу в PL/SQL!
Детальный ответ
Как создать таблицу в PL/SQL?
В PL/SQL, создание таблицы является очень важной задачей, поскольку таблицы являются основой структуры данных в базе данных. В этой статье мы разберем, как создать таблицу в PL/SQL.
Использование оператора CREATE TABLE
Для создания таблицы в PL/SQL мы используем оператор CREATE TABLE. Оператор CREATE TABLE создает новую таблицу и определяет ее структуру и атрибуты.
Вот основный синтаксис оператора CREATE TABLE:
CREATE TABLE table_name
(
column1 data_type1,
column2 data_type2,
column3 data_type3,
...
);
Здесь table_name - это имя таблицы, column1, column2, column3 - это имена столбцов таблицы, а data_type1, data_type2, data_type3 - это типы данных столбцов.
Пример
Давайте рассмотрим пример создания таблицы "Employees" с несколькими столбцами.
CREATE TABLE Employees
(
employee_id NUMBER,
first_name VARCHAR2(50),
last_name VARCHAR2(50),
hire_date DATE,
salary NUMBER(10,2)
);
В этом примере мы определяем таблицу "Employees" с пятью столбцами: employee_id, first_name, last_name, hire_date и salary. Столбец "employee_id" имеет тип данных NUMBER, столбцы "first_name" и "last_name" имеют тип данных VARCHAR2 с максимальной длиной 50 символов, столбец "hire_date" имеет тип данных DATE и столбец "salary" имеет числовой тип данных NUMBER с десятью общими цифрами и двумя десятичными символами.
Вы также можете добавить ограничения к столбцам, такие как ограничение на уникальность или ограничение на внешний ключ. Вот пример с добавленными ограничениями:
CREATE TABLE Employees
(
employee_id NUMBER,
first_name VARCHAR2(50) NOT NULL,
last_name VARCHAR2(50) NOT NULL,
hire_date DATE,
salary NUMBER(10,2),
CONSTRAINT pk_Employees PRIMARY KEY (employee_id),
CONSTRAINT uq_Employees UNIQUE (first_name, last_name)
);
В этом примере у нас есть два ограничения: PRIMARY KEY (основной ключ) на столбце "employee_id" и UNIQUE (уникальность) на столбцах "first_name" и "last_name".
Заключение
В этой статье мы рассмотрели, как создать таблицу в PL/SQL с помощью оператора CREATE TABLE. Мы изучили основной синтаксис оператора и рассмотрели примеры создания таблицы с различными типами данных и ограничениями. Теперь у вас есть достаточно информации, чтобы начать создавать таблицы в PL/SQL!